how long does it take to see an embryo? My little white hen, Sweetie, has been brooding for two days, and i do not know if i should lose hope if i find nothing?

I can see embryonic development at 2 days into incubation when I candle the egg, but it's best to wait for day 5-7 to candle the egg, as that is when the veining is really apparent. In other words, I would wait another week and then candle the eggs. Either that or just leave her alone for 21 days (occasionally checking for rotten eggs) and see if something fuzzy pops out from underneath her.
